  Published: 2015-11-19, Author: Rossen , review by: laptopmedia.com

  • Sturdy construction and sleek design with customizable LEDs, Good keyboard with 3 zones of LED backlight, macro keys and responsive touchpad, Top-shelf hardware crammed inside a 15-inch laptop, Various storage configurations including two speedy M.2 NVMe
  • Bulky (34 mm profile) and heavy (3.21 kg), Mediocre screen quality with low sRGB color gamut coverage and low maximum brightness
  • Generally, the Alienware 15 R2 is what we are used to seeing from the brand. The notebook has a bulky and heavy body, but manages to compensate with outstanding design, rigid construction made of premium materials and extremely powerful hardware that's ra...

  Published: 2015-11-14, Author: Andreas , review by: notebookcheck.net

  • excellent performance with good Turbo utilization, sophisticated chassis, good input devices, useful tools, comprehensive illumination, long battery runtimes, decent sound, good cooling solution, optional graphics amplifier, matte IPS panel, very fast Wi
  • display way too dark, low color space coverage, loud under load, GPU throttling in extreme situations, slightly complicated maintenance, no SSD or hybrid hard drive by default
  • The first review sample of the Alienware 15 with the Nvidia GeForce GTX 970M was already very convincing and got a very good rating. The model with the Radeon R9 M295X on the other hand had some issues and was not a good alternative. With its brand-new Sk...
